Frequently asked questions about New Life Charter Academy

How many students attend New Life Charter Academy?

New Life Charter Academy has 110 students enrolled. It is an elementary school in Fort Lauderdale, FL. CCD year-over-year: 122 (2022-23) → 111 (2023-24), down 11.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at New Life Charter Academy?

27.9% of students at New Life Charter Academy are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Florida average of 52.0%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of New Life Charter Academy?

The largest demographic group at New Life Charter Academy is Hispanic or Latino at 47.3% of enrollment, in Fort Lauderdale, FL.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 56.7/100.
